Read moreOrganizing a bookshelf can be both a rewarding and evolving task, especially when you have a diverse collection that includes series books, standalone novels, and unique items like crystals and gems. From my experience, one helpful strategy is to start by grouping your series books together but allow flexibility since not all volumes may be available or in place yet. I often use temporary placeholders or notes to mark spots or missing titles to maintain order and track what’s still needed. Incorporating crystals and gems into your bookshelf setup adds a lovely aesthetic and can create a calming environment perfect for reading or relaxation. For example, placing amethyst or rose quartz near your books can promote tranquility and focus, which enhances your overall reading experience. These natural elements also make your bookshelf feel personalized and spiritually uplifting. Remember, maintaining a bookshelf is a continuous process. As you acquire new books or crystals, adjusting the arrangement keeps your space fresh and functional. Don't hesitate to experiment with different organizational styles, such as sorting by genre, color, or author, depending on your preference. The key is to balance accessibility with visual appeal.
